Job Demand & Supply Dynamics

Kenya's e-commerce and retail technology sector has experienced pronounced demand acceleration since 2020, driven by pandemic-induced digital adoption and sustained consumer behavior shifts. The Kenya National Bureau of Statistics indicates that information and communication technology sector employment grew by approximately 15-18% annually between 2020-2023, with e-commerce and retail tech roles representing an estimated 25-30% of this expansion. Critical demand concentrations exist in software development, digital marketing specialists, data analysts, and mobile payment integration roles. Full-stack developers and mobile application engineers command particularly acute demand, with vacancy postings increasing by an estimated 40-50% since 2020. Customer experience specialists and logistics optimization analysts have emerged as secondary growth areas, reflecting sector maturation requirements. Supply constraints remain substantial despite expanding educational infrastructure. Kenyan universities produce approximately 8,000-10,000 technology graduates annually, according to the Ministry of Education data, yet only 20-25% enter e-commerce or retail technology roles directly upon graduation. This creates an estimated annual talent shortfall of 2,500-3,500 qualified professionals across the sector. Average vacancy durations for specialized roles extend 4-6 months, with senior positions remaining unfilled for 6-9 months. The World Bank's Kenya Digital Economy Assessment suggests this gap will persist through 2025-2026 without accelerated skills development interventions and enhanced industry-academia collaboration frameworks.

E-commerce and retail technology roles in Kenya demonstrate distinct compensation patterns compared to general IT positions, reflecting the sector's rapid digitization and specialized skill requirements. The Kenya National Bureau of Statistics indicates that technology sector wages have grown 12-15% annually over the past three years, with e-commerce roles commanding premiums of 20-35% above traditional IT functions due to their direct revenue impact and scarcity of experienced professionals. Median salary bands reflect this premium positioning, with senior roles approaching regional parity with South African markets. Digital marketing managers and e-commerce platform specialists represent the fastest-growing compensation segments, driven by increased consumer digital adoption and cross-border trading initiatives. The Central Bank of Kenya's digital payments data shows transaction volumes growing 28% year-over-year, creating sustained demand for specialized technical talent.

Nairobi commands salary premiums of 25-40% over secondary cities like Mombasa and Kisumu, though hybrid work arrangements are narrowing these gaps. Retention bonuses averaging 15-20% of base salary have become standard practice, while remote work flexibility serves as a non-monetary differentiator for talent acquisition.

HR Challenges & Organisational Demands

Kenya's e-commerce and retail technology sector confronts five critical human capital frictions that demand immediate strategic intervention. Traditional job architectures, built around fixed role definitions, increasingly misalign with dynamic skill requirements as organizations pivot toward agile, project-based delivery models. This structural disconnect creates inefficiencies in talent deployment and limits organizational responsiveness to market demands. Retention challenges in specialized technical domains present acute operational risks. Data scientists, AI engineers, and cybersecurity professionals demonstrate attrition rates exceeding 35% annually, driven by competitive market dynamics and limited local talent pipelines. Organizations struggle to maintain continuity in mission-critical capabilities while competing against global remote opportunities offering premium compensation packages. Hybrid work arrangements introduce complex governance challenges, particularly around performance measurement and regulatory compliance. Traditional oversight mechanisms prove inadequate for distributed teams, requiring new frameworks for accountability and quality assurance that balance flexibility with operational control. Leadership capabilities require fundamental recalibration from directive management toward orchestration of diverse, often remote talent ecosystems. This transition demands new competencies in digital collaboration, cross-functional coordination, and outcome-based performance management. HR functions face pressure to evolve beyond administrative roles toward strategic analytics-driven transformation. Organizations require sophisticated workforce planning, predictive turnover modeling, and skills gap analysis capabilities to maintain competitive advantage in rapidly evolving market conditions.

Future-Oriented Roles & Skills (2030 Horizon)

Kenya's e-commerce and retail technology sector will generate distinct professional roles driven by technological convergence and regulatory evolution. AI Governance Officers will emerge as organizations navigate Kenya's anticipated data protection amendments and algorithmic accountability requirements, managing compliance frameworks while optimizing automated decision-making systems. Sustainable IT Engineers will address growing environmental mandates, designing energy-efficient infrastructure aligned with Kenya's carbon neutrality commitments under international climate agreements. Customer Experience Automation Specialists will orchestrate omnichannel personalization engines, integrating voice commerce, augmented reality, and predictive analytics to serve Kenya's increasingly sophisticated digital consumers. Cross-Border Commerce Compliance Managers will navigate complex regulatory landscapes as intra-African trade digitization accelerates through AfCFTA implementation. Digital Supply Chain Orchestrators will manage end-to-end visibility platforms connecting Kenyan retailers with continental supplier networks. Human-AI Collaboration Designers will create interfaces optimizing workforce productivity alongside intelligent automation systems. These roles fundamentally alter hiring profiles, requiring interdisciplinary competencies spanning technology, regulatory knowledge, and business strategy. Risk profiles shift toward data governance, algorithmic bias, and cross-jurisdictional compliance rather than traditional operational concerns. Critical skill clusters include AI literacy encompassing machine learning interpretation and bias detection, regulatory automation capabilities for dynamic compliance management, green computing proficiency in sustainable technology design, and human-digital collaboration expertise in workforce augmentation strategies.

Kenya's e-commerce and retail technology sector demonstrates varying automation susceptibility across core functions, with engineering roles showing 35-40% automatable tasks primarily in code generation, testing frameworks, and routine debugging. Quality assurance functions exhibit higher automation potential at 55-65%, particularly in regression testing, performance monitoring, and defect tracking. Operations roles face 45-50% task automation through infrastructure management, deployment pipelines, and system monitoring tools. Reporting and analytics functions show 60-70% automation potential in data extraction, dashboard generation, and standard performance metrics compilation. Role transformation patterns reveal distinct trajectories. Software engineers and product managers experience significant augmentation rather than replacement, with productivity gains of 25-30% through AI-assisted coding and automated testing protocols. Conversely, manual QA testers and junior operations staff face potential workforce reduction of 15-20% as automated testing and DevOps practices mature. Customer service representatives show mixed outcomes, with chatbot implementation reducing routine inquiry handling by 40% while creating demand for complex problem resolution specialists. Redeployment initiatives across major Kenyan e-commerce platforms achieve 60-65% success rates when accompanied by structured reskilling programs. Workers transitioning from manual testing to automation engineering or from basic operations to cloud architecture management demonstrate strongest adaptation outcomes. Aggregate productivity improvements reach 20-25% sector-wide, though implementation costs and training investments require 18-24 month payback periods for sustainable transformation.

Macroeconomic & Investment Outlook

Kenya's macroeconomic fundamentals present a mixed environment for e-commerce and retail technology workforce expansion. The Kenya National Bureau of Statistics reports GDP growth averaging 5.2% over 2022-2023, with services contributing approximately 54% of total output. However, inflation reached 9.6% in mid-2023 before moderating to 6.8% by year-end, creating wage pressure across technology roles. Government digital infrastructure investments through the Digital Economy Blueprint allocate approximately USD 2.1 billion through 2030, with 40% earmarked for digital skills development and technology adoption programs. The Ajira Digital Program has facilitated over 850,000 digital job placements since inception, though primarily in lower-skill categories. Private sector capital expenditure in retail technology infrastructure increased 23% year-over-year in 2023, driven by mobile payment integration and inventory management system upgrades. Conservative projections indicate e-commerce and retail technology roles will expand by 15,000-18,000 positions through 2025, accelerating to 35,000-42,000 cumulative new roles by 2030. Growth concentrates in mobile commerce development, payment systems integration, and supply chain optimization. However, currency volatility and elevated borrowing costs may constrain smaller retailer technology adoption, potentially limiting job creation to the lower end of projected ranges.

E-commerce and retail technology talent in Kenya demonstrates a distinctive skill architecture that reflects both global digital commerce requirements and regional market dynamics. The talent pool exhibits competency across three primary skill blocks, each carrying different levels of market penetration and development maturity. Core technical capabilities form the foundation, encompassing full-stack web development, mobile application development for Android and iOS platforms, payment gateway integration, and database management systems. Kenyan professionals show particular strength in PHP, JavaScript, Python, and Java programming languages, with growing proficiency in cloud platforms including AWS and Microsoft Azure. API development and third-party service integration represent well-established competencies, driven by the country's advanced mobile money ecosystem and fintech integration requirements. Business and compliance skills constitute the second block, focusing on data privacy regulations, financial services compliance, and cross-border transaction protocols. Understanding of Kenya's Data Protection Act and regional regulatory frameworks demonstrates increasing sophistication, though gaps remain in international compliance standards such as GDPR implementation. Emerging technology adoption represents the third skill block, where AI-powered recommendation engines, machine learning for fraud detection, and predictive analytics show nascent but accelerating development. Green IT practices and quantum-resistant security protocols remain largely theoretical, with limited practical implementation across the current talent base.

Talent Migration Patterns

Kenya's e-commerce and retail technology sector demonstrates distinctive migration patterns that reflect both regional dynamics and global talent flows. International inflows primarily originate from neighboring East African markets, with Uganda, Tanzania, and Rwanda contributing approximately 35% of foreign-born hires according to Kenya National Bureau of Statistics employment surveys. These professionals typically possess specialized skills in mobile payment systems and cross-border logistics, areas where regional experience translates effectively to Kenya's market conditions. Secondary hub migration patterns reveal Kenya's position as a talent magnet within the broader African technology ecosystem. Professionals from Nigeria's fintech sector and South Africa's retail technology companies increasingly view Nairobi as an attractive destination, driven by lower operational costs and expanding market opportunities. This trend has intensified following the establishment of major regional headquarters by international e-commerce platforms. Foreign-born professionals constitute approximately 18% of senior-level hires in Kenya's e-commerce and retail technology sector, significantly above the 8% average across all industries. Technical roles in software engineering and data analytics show the highest concentration of international talent, with 22% of positions filled by non-Kenyan nationals. The government's work permit reforms in 2019 have facilitated this influx, though visa processing timelines remain a constraint for rapid scaling requirements.

University & Academic Pipeline

Kenya's e-commerce and retail technology sector draws talent from a concentrated group of universities, though formal tracking of graduate placement remains limited. The University of Nairobi, Kenya's largest public institution, produces approximately 15-20% of its computer science and business graduates entering e-commerce roles, according to institutional surveys. Strathmore University demonstrates higher sector-specific placement rates, with roughly 25-30% of its information technology graduates joining retail technology companies or e-commerce startups. Kenyatta University and Jomo Kenyatta University of Agriculture and Technology contribute significantly to the pipeline, particularly in systems development and digital marketing roles. Technical University of Kenya focuses on practical applications, with approximately 20% of graduates entering retail technology positions. The formal apprenticeship framework remains underdeveloped compared to traditional sectors. However, coding bootcamps have emerged as alternative pathways, with programs like Moringa School and AkiraChix producing job-ready developers within 6-12 months. Government policy initiatives align with broader digitization goals outlined in Vision 2030. The World Bank's Digital Economy for Africa initiative supports skills development programs, while OECD assessments highlight Kenya's progress in digital literacy compared to regional peers. These efforts target bridging the gap between academic preparation and industry requirements in the rapidly evolving e-commerce landscape.

Largest Hiring Companies & Competitive Landscape

Kenya's e-commerce and retail technology sector demonstrates a concentrated hiring landscape dominated by both domestic market leaders and international technology giants establishing regional operations. Jumia Kenya remains the largest single employer in pure-play e-commerce, maintaining substantial workforce requirements across logistics, customer service, and technology development functions. The company's pan-African model necessitates significant local hiring to support last-mile delivery and customer acquisition strategies. Safaricom emerges as the dominant force through its M-Pesa ecosystem and expanding digital commerce initiatives, leveraging its telecommunications infrastructure to capture retail technology opportunities. The company's workforce strategy emphasizes technical talent acquisition for fintech integration and mobile commerce platform development. Twiga Foods represents another significant employer, focusing on agricultural supply chain digitization and requiring specialized logistics and technology personnel. International technology companies increasingly compete for top-tier talent through regional hub establishments. Amazon Web Services and Microsoft have intensified recruitment for cloud infrastructure roles supporting e-commerce growth across East Africa. These global players typically offer compensation packages exceeding local market rates, creating talent retention challenges for domestic companies. Local retailers including Naivas and Carrefour Kenya have expanded their technology hiring to support omnichannel strategies, though their workforce requirements remain smaller than dedicated e-commerce platforms. Competition centers on software engineers, data analysts, and digital marketing specialists with regional market knowledge.

Kenya's e-commerce and retail technology sector demonstrates pronounced geographic concentration, with Nairobi commanding the dominant position while secondary cities emerge as viable alternatives for specific talent categories. Nairobi maintains its position as the undisputed hub for e-commerce and retail technology talent, hosting approximately 85% of the sector's workforce. The capital's mature ecosystem supports both established players and emerging startups, creating sustained demand across technical and commercial functions. Supply constraints remain acute, particularly for senior technical roles, with the talent supply ratio indicating significant competition among employers. Mombasa represents the primary alternative to Nairobi, leveraging its position as East Africa's logistics gateway to develop specialized capabilities in supply chain technology and last-mile delivery solutions. The coastal city benefits from lower operational costs while maintaining reasonable access to technical talent, though the overall workforce remains substantially smaller than the capital. Kisumu and Eldoret function as emerging nodes, primarily serving as cost-effective locations for customer service operations and basic technical support functions. These cities offer attractive cost arbitrage opportunities, though limited local talent pools constrain their viability for complex technical roles.
